Games with the Greatest Narratives for Any Event
If you are looking for the most engaging and exciting story games to play, the recommendations that are listed below are some of the best options to take into consideration:
Dixit
Through the use of abstract images, players of the visually stunning game Dixit can narrate short stories. The goal of this narrative game is to be creative without being overt, which makes it the perfect narrative game for stimulating the imagination.
Rory’s Story Cubes
After rolling dice that have pictures on them, players are tasked with coming up with a narrative that is based on the images that appear on the die. This game requires a lot of smart thinking. Once Upon a Time
A card-based storytelling game where players compete to weave a tale using specific elements. It’s one of the best story games for those who love fairy tales and fantasy.
Gloom
Players are tasked with writing tragic tales for their characters in the game Gloom, which is filled with dark comedy. Groups who value innovation and drama are the perfect candidates for this idea.
Story Wars
After each of the players in the game has presented their own interpretation of a narrative that is based on a prompt, the group then votes on which participant’s version is the most compelling overall interpretation. How to Use Multiple Stories in Discussions
It is possible to make talks more dynamic and inclusive by using multiple stories in the course of the discourse. This is how you can accomplish it:
Start with a Prompt: Begin with a broad question or theme, such as “Tell us about a time you overcame a challenge.”
Encourage Varied Perspectives: Invite everyone to share their unique take on the topic, ensuring multiple stories are told.
Connect the Dots: Keep an eye out for recurring ideas or lessons that might be gleaned from the various narrative elements.

Table Topics Questions to Spark Great Conversations

Topics for discussion at the table are an excellent method to maintain meaningful and dynamic conversations. Listed below are some questions that can help you begin moving:
If you could relive any day of your life, which one would it be and why?
What’s the most memorable story from your childhood?
If you could write a book, what would it be about?
What’s the best piece of advice you’ve ever received?
If you could have dinner with any historical figure, who would it be and why?

Tips for Hosting a Successful Story Game Night
Choose the Right Game: Pick the best story game that suits your group’s interests and energy level.
Set the Tone: Your goal should be to establish a setting that is kind and welcoming, one in which everyone is comfortable expressing their thoughts and ideas without fear of judgment or reprisal.
Use Table Topics: Incorporate table topic questions to keep the conversation flowing between games.
Encourage Creativity: Keep in mind that there is no such thing as an improper answer when it comes to the art of storytelling. This is very important to keep in mind.
Celebrate Diversity: Embrace the multiple stories that emerge, as they add richness to the experience.
